mirror of
https://github.com/qbittorrent/qBittorrent.git
synced 2026-01-01 05:08:05 -06:00
Disable move constructor where it is sensible
This commit is contained in:
@@ -35,7 +35,7 @@
|
||||
class LogFilterModel final : public QSortFilterProxyModel
|
||||
{
|
||||
Q_OBJECT
|
||||
Q_DISABLE_COPY(LogFilterModel)
|
||||
Q_DISABLE_COPY_MOVE(LogFilterModel)
|
||||
|
||||
public:
|
||||
explicit LogFilterModel(Log::MsgTypes types = Log::ALL, QObject *parent = nullptr);
|
||||
|
||||
@@ -34,7 +34,7 @@
|
||||
class LogListView final : public QListView
|
||||
{
|
||||
Q_OBJECT
|
||||
Q_DISABLE_COPY(LogListView)
|
||||
Q_DISABLE_COPY_MOVE(LogListView)
|
||||
|
||||
public:
|
||||
explicit LogListView(QWidget *parent = nullptr);
|
||||
|
||||
@@ -39,7 +39,7 @@
|
||||
|
||||
class BaseLogModel : public QAbstractListModel
|
||||
{
|
||||
Q_DISABLE_COPY(BaseLogModel)
|
||||
Q_DISABLE_COPY_MOVE(BaseLogModel)
|
||||
|
||||
public:
|
||||
enum MessageTypeRole
|
||||
@@ -86,7 +86,7 @@ private:
|
||||
class LogMessageModel : public BaseLogModel
|
||||
{
|
||||
Q_OBJECT
|
||||
Q_DISABLE_COPY(LogMessageModel)
|
||||
Q_DISABLE_COPY_MOVE(LogMessageModel)
|
||||
|
||||
public:
|
||||
explicit LogMessageModel(QObject *parent = nullptr);
|
||||
@@ -101,7 +101,7 @@ private:
|
||||
class LogPeerModel : public BaseLogModel
|
||||
{
|
||||
Q_OBJECT
|
||||
Q_DISABLE_COPY(LogPeerModel)
|
||||
Q_DISABLE_COPY_MOVE(LogPeerModel)
|
||||
|
||||
public:
|
||||
explicit LogPeerModel(QObject *parent = nullptr);
|
||||
|
||||
Reference in New Issue
Block a user